H Pot Chimney Inserts: Managing Chimney Draught with H Pot Design

What H Pots Are and How the Insert Functions



Chimney pots assist with directing smoke safely away from the building while maintaining airflow through the flue. Among the various chimney pot options, H pots stand out because of their recognisable structure and airflow management.



Rather than depending solely on stack height or a single outlet, an H pot insert joins two upright flues using a horizontal chamber. This structure manages airflow more evenly across the flue openings.



The overall structure forms the shape of the letter “H”, which explains the name. Wind moving across the chimney head passes over the openings rather than forcing air downward. This design limits the chance of smoke being forced back into the chimney shaft.



Properties affected by regular downdraught may see improved airflow with an H pot insert. Many heritage buildings already feature H pots as part of their chimney design.

The Role of H Pots in Preventing Downdraught



Downdraught occurs when wind forces air downward through the chimney rather than allowing smoke to rise. This can result in smoke entering living spaces or reduced efficiency in fireplaces and stoves.



The insert allows air to move across the top openings rather than forcing air into them. This airflow movement supports upward draught and improves ventilation.




  • Less likelihood of smoke returning into rooms

  • Improved airflow stability

  • Improved appliance efficiency

  • Less impact from crosswinds



Properties exposed to strong winds frequently use H pots to stabilise airflow.

Materials and Durability of H Pots



H pots are usually produced from kiln-fired clay or ceramic materials. The firing process creates a strong structure suitable for outdoor use.




  • Resistant to heat produced by fireplaces and stoves

  • Simple long-term maintenance

  • Compatible with traditional brick chimney stacks

  • Designed for extended service life



Because of their durability, ceramic H pots remain widely used on both modern homes and period properties.
